What band dominated rock and roll in the 1960’s?

Rock and roll music in the 1960s was dominated by one group: the Beatles. Launched in Liverpool, England, this four-man group first appeared in the United States in 1964 on The Ed Sullivan Show. The popularity of the Beatles remained strong throughout the decade.

What is folk rock band?

Folk rock combines the pure diatonic harmonies of traditional folk and country music with the energy, rhythms, and instrumentation of rock music. A typical folk rock band might feature electric guitar, acoustic guitar, electric bass guitar, drums, and other instruments like the mandolin, banjo, fiddle, and piano.

    What was early American folk music?

    From the onset of American history, folk music has shown up at times when the people needed it most. The earliest folk songs rose from slave fields as spirituals such as “Down by the Riverside” and “We Shall Overcome.” These are songs about struggle and hardship but are also full of hope.
